Abstract

In this paper, a new digital watermarking scheme that uses human visual system and the quadtree decomposition technique is proposed. The watermark image is split into the insignificant and significant parts respectively according to their importance in the image, then the split watermarks are embedded perceptually into the spatial and frequency domains. The embedding energy relies on the minimally-noticeable-distortion (MND) energy of the embedded position either in the spatial or frequency domain. Experimental results show that the proposed scheme can resist the attacks such as image cropping, etc.
